Transaction 2924e188665381832f54018204d2705d77dc48d890a53514c9f393759251beaa

1 Input
2 Outputs
  • 2924e188665381832f54018204d2705d77dc48d890a53514c9f393759251beaa:0
  • value  4581
    address  16oqdDkSav6MwiyXJ2qtnXufA5HwepL9VF
  • 2924e188665381832f54018204d2705d77dc48d890a53514c9f393759251beaa:1
  • value  8407754
    address  3JDQKegSjuGtCyiAGTvopTRM6z7gEX4dmn